首页|多效唑对西克刺桐生理特性和花芽分化的影响

[目的]探明多效唑诱导刺桐花芽分化的生理特性,为刺桐花期调控提供理论依据.[方法]以8 a生西克刺桐为试材,测定喷施多效唑后叶片的光合色素、可溶性糖、可溶性蛋白和内源激素等生理指标,分析多效唑对西克刺桐花芽分化的影响.[结果]喷施 1.0~3.0 g/L多效唑,能显著提高刺桐叶片的叶绿素和类胡萝卜素含量,促进可溶性糖和可溶性蛋白生成,且各含量均随着多效唑浓度增加呈现先升后降的变化,多效唑浓度为 2.0 g/L时均达到最大值;多效唑提高了叶片全碳含量、降低全氮含量,导致碳氮比值提高;多效唑显著降低叶片GA3 和IAA含量,提高ZR和ABA含量,造成ZR/IAA、ZR/GA3、ABA/IAA和ABA/GA3 比值升高;多效唑显著提高西克刺桐枝条成花率,其中 2.0 g/L和 3.0 g/L多效唑更有利于西克刺桐的花芽分化.[结论]多效唑有利于促进西克刺桐叶片碳水化合物的生成,提高碳氮比值,调节内源激素平衡,促进西克刺桐的花芽分化,喷施浓度以 2.0 g/L效果最好.
Effect of Paclobutrazol on the Physiological Characteristics and Flower Bud Differentiation of Erythrina sykesii
[Objective]In order to explore the physiological characteristics of flower bud differentiation of Erythrina sykesii.induced by paclobutrazol and provide a theoretical basis for the regulation of flowering period.[Method]Using 8-year-old Erythrina sykesii as the test material,physiological indicators such as photosynthetic pigment,soluble sugar,soluble protein,and endogenous hormone were measured after spraying paclobutrazol,and the effect of paclobutrazol on flower bud differentiation of Erythrina sykesii was analyzed.[Result]Spraying 1.0-3.0 g/L paclobutrazol significantly increased the content of chlorophyll and carotenoid in leaves of Erythrina sykesii,promoted the generation of soluble sugars and proteins.The content of photosynthetic pigments,soluble sugars,and soluble proteins all showed an initial increase followed by a decrease with the increase of paclobutrazol concentration.The maximum values of their contents were reached when spraying 2.0 g/L paclobutrazol.Spraying paclobutrazol increased total carbon content and decreased total nitrogen content in leaf,resulting in the increase of ratio of carbon to nitrogen.Spraying paclobutrazol significantly reduced the content of GA3 and IAA in leaves,while increasing the content of ZR and ABA,resulting in an increase in ZR/IAA,ZR/GA3,ABA/IAA,and ABA/GA3 ratios.Spraying paclobutrazol significantly increased the branches flowering rate of Erythrina sykesii,with 2.0 and 3.0 g/L paclobutrazol being most beneficial for the differentiation flower buds of Erythrina sykesii.[Conclusion]Spraying paclobutrazol is beneficial for promoting the generation of carbohydrates,increasing the carbon to nitrogen ratio,regulating the balance of endogenous hormones,and thus promoting the differentiation of flower buds in Erythrina sykesii.The best effect was obtained when spraying 2.0 g/L paclobutrazol.
